Is 1000 rpm good for car?

Is 1000 rpm good for car?

In most of today’s cars, an idle speed of 600 to 1000 RPMs is average. If your car is idling rough, though, it won’t feel smooth. The RPMs will jump up and down, for example, or they’ll fall below 600 RPM (or whatever is typical for your vehicle).

How many RPMs is 80 mph?

The RPM you’re seeing is a function of your speed (80 MPH), your sixth gear’s ratio (0.756), your differential’s ratio (3.91) and your tires’ circumference. Those items are essentially fixed, so you’re going to see roughly 3,200 to 3,300 RPM at 80 MPH.
